Description
Summary :
This Interventional Radiology (IR) Technologist is
responsible for helping perform a variety of complex specialized
tasks, including but not limited to, operating fluoroscopy,
computed tomography, laser, and ultrasonography equipment during
vascular and neuroradiology angiographic and interventional
procedures. This individual is responsible for helping develop and
implement systems to ensure the smooth and efficient flow of
patients for procedures in the Interventional labs. Duties for this
position include, but are not limited to : circulating and scrubbing
roles during procedures, patient teaching, assisting with patient
care within the scope of practice, inventory management, and
schedule coordination. The IR Technologist must be able to
troubleshoot basic maintenance, participate in QA, and resolve
issues related to image processing and the image archiving system.
Expectation to participate in ongoing education, safety, and
technical advances within their scope of licensure. The IR
Technologist will adhere to, and maintain, the expected imaging
competencies as outlined by management. Behavior and communication
skills must align with the organization's mission, values, and
culture.

Job
Requirements : Education / Skills
Graduate of an accredited school of Radiology
Technology or other accepted and approved equivalent
required
Experience
1 year of training / experience in special
procedures preferred
Basic computer experience
required
Licenses,
Registrations, or Certifications
Radiography (R) by ARRT is
required
Vascular Interventional Radiography
(VI) by ARRT is required within 2 years
State
Licensure required
Texas : MRT by
TMB
Louisiana : LRT (R) or (F) by
LSRTBE
New Mexico : RRT by MIRTP
NMED
BLS
required
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S)
preferred
